The summer transfer window is open in England with more countries soon to follow suit, and there is plenty of gossip swirling around. Transfer Talk brings you all the latest buzz on rumours, comings, goings and, of course, done deals!

TOP STORY: Gunners make first move for Koundé

Barcelona have asked for time to respond to Arsenal's undisclosed offer for Jules Koundé, according to Diario Sport.

The Blaugrana's delicate financial situation means that Marc-André ter Stegen, Hector Fort, Pau Cubarsí, Gavi, Fermín López and Lamine Yamal are the only players that they won't consider letting leave.

Koundé is among the Barca players who are in the highest demand, especially as the 25-year-old has proven that he can perform at both centre-back and right-back. There has been further evidence of that during the Euros, with Koundé playing an important role in France reaching the quarterfinals.

Barca are counting on Koundé but Arsenal have already contacted them about a possible transfer and the Catalan club need funds. With that in mind, they have asked the Gunners to give them time to respond, as the possibility of Koundé leaving is directly linked to Ronald Araujo's future.

Barca have already told Arsenal that Koundé will be staying put if the Uruguayan departs, but they will be willing to negotiate if he stays. Even if negotiations do take place, the Blaugrana will reportedly not let the Frenchman leave for less than €60 million. The defender has a contract that lasts until 2027 and includes a release clause worth €1,000m.

PAPER GOSSIP

- Chelsea are pushing to sign Athletic Club winger Nico Williams, reports Diario Sport, which adds that the Blues are willing to trigger the 21-year-old's €60m release clause and offer him a fee between €15m and €20m. They also want to move quickly to capitalise on Barcelona's financial issues, but the Blaugrana remain confident that they will sign the Spain international as his priority is to play for them.

- Désiré Doué is on the list of players that Bayern Munich are looking at and Stade Rennais are aware of the Bavarian club's interest, according to Florian Plettenberg. The 19-year-old winger could become a serious option for this window if Bayern offload more players or they could wait until 2025 to make a move.

- Bayern Munich bosses have agreed basic contract details such as length and salary with the representatives of Paris Saint-Germain attacking midfielder Xavi Simons, reports Sky Sports Deutschland. They are also in concrete negotiations with PSG, but the 21-year-old hasn't decided where he wants to play next season. A return to RB Leipzig is still reportedly an option.

- Barcelona are leading the race to sign RB Leipzig attacking midfielder Dani Olmo, according to Nicolo Schira. This comes after the journalist had reported that Manchester United and Manchester City had also been trying to sign the 26-year-old with Leipzig wanting €60m for him.

- AC Milan hope to sign Chelsea trio Romelu Lukaku, Carney Chukwuemeka and Trevoh Chalobah, according to La Gazzetta dello Sport, which adds that the Serie A club is also in pole position to sign AS Monaco midfielder Youssouf Fofana. None of the Blues players mentioned are part of new coach Enzo Maresca's plans.
